微信小程序可以用gulp,webpack吗?

微信小程序可以用gulp,webpack吗?怎么用啊,有例子吗?

阅读 9.1k
4 个回答

微信小程序是微信前端开发团队实现的一套基于JavaScript开发单页面应用的框架解决方案,就我个人理解,和react、vue这些前端框架的设计理念是差不多的,借助于微信的api接口能实现一些特定的功能,因为小程序其实是基于JavaScript开发的,所以里面会写很多JavaScript逻辑代码,所以就我个人理解,是可以用到gulp这类脚手架工具的,不过,为了方便开发者开发,微信官方开发了一套从开发、测试、发布、打包的开发工具,应该到时候不会用到gulp、webpack(因为没内测资格,所以我这里只做猜想)。

ps:

  • 微信小程序开发文档

  • 不知道一些人什么心态,这个问题问得又没什么的,竟然有好几个人投反对票...

你说的这俩一个是自动化构件的工具,一个是打包工具。不知道你想问什么,如果是开发微信后台,直接去看官方的api,找个会用的框架改改用吧。

微信小程序默认启用了strict模式,一般情况下没有问题,当你的代码里用到 global的时候会出问题,因为webpack提供global变量的时候是这样的

(function(global){
... your code
}).call(export,function(){return this}())

重点在于return this 在strict 模式下会返回 undefined

19年的我看到了最开始的回答现在可用glup 跟webpack 拉

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题